80 CA pickup stalls on deceleraion

Hello, this is my first post here. I bought 1980 Toyota pickup which have not run for 2 years. The fuel pump was defunct, I replaced it and had all vacuum lines connected in accord with diagram on the hood. It is CA version. One hell of the carburetor I must say

Now, I have to have it smogged and I have two issues.

First if I adjust idle to 900 rpm it goes in waves - rpm rises up then drops then rises up again.

Second, when driving it stalls upon deceleration - I have to heel-and-toe it all the time..

any advice on this ? also, any advice on good shops in Sacramento area capable to smog carb yotas would be appreciated... I understand that I have to keep the stock carb to pass CA smog ?

PS I do not see much change when I mess with a mixture screw, so I set it up to default 1 and 1/2 turns out.
